TV stations struggle as Nielsens start up - Hawaii Business

Full story: Honolulu Star-Bulletin

The Nielsen ratings start today, just as one newly merged newsroom operation works to smooth over transmission challenges and another newsroom awaits delivery of a computer part to make sure it can deliver newscasts to its audience.
